Now THIS I like-'57 Ford

This is one of the nicest '57 Fords I've seen for a very long time.

'57 Ford Custom two-door sedan. Model 70-D (no rear seat). Canadian Barrie Poole built Cobra Jet 428. Further modified with a Tremec 5-speed and Currie nine inch. A whole list of modifications, but very clean and stock looking. Even the factory wheels were widened to accommodate modern rubber.

I like it. A lot.
